Download the manual for the RX22 for better cleaning info and follow the recommendations re locktite on the cocking spring retainer .. You should consider this prior to your first shooting .. Pm ( private message me ) for a link to a US site with lots of info on preventative mods .. The ISSC had some early problems with light primer strikes and this site seems to cover it all .. I took delivery of a unit last week ( black) and it seems to have many of the modifications suggested upgraded by the factory, yet the 108 screws were updated but not sealed with locktite . The washers were upgraded to lock washers on these bolts and the bolt length was increased .
